1. The SOP Granulation Challenge
Sulfate of potash (SOP) is a high value chlorine free chloride-free potassium fertilizer. Its delvers potassium and sulfur essential for sensitive crops like tobacco, citrus, and potatoes. However, in crystalline or powdered form, SOP is hard to handle and create agronomic problems. It creates hazardous and wasteful dust, cakes solidly in storage and undergoes segregation in blended fertilizers.

2. The Dry Granulation Solution: How It Works
The double roller granulator for SOP fertilizer or roller press compactor uses powerful hydraulic engine. It is a core component of the dry granulation production line offered by LANE Heavy Industry.
Feeding: Powdered SOP fertilizer is uniformly fed by screw feeder into the machines core
Compaction: Two heavy-duty, parallel rollers rotating inward apply immense pressure (tens of tons per centimeter). This pressure compacts the SOP powder into a solid, continuous sheet or “flake,” relying on the material’s natural molecular binding properties—no liquid binders are needed.
Granulation: This dense flake is then mechanically crushed and screened in an integrated system. The result is uniformly sized, hard SOP granules. Oversized particles are re-crushed, and fines are automatically recycled back to the feeder, ensuring zero waste.

3. Key Advantages of the Double Roller Method
Choosing a LANE double roller granulator for SOP fertilizer production delivers compelling benefits over alternative granulation technologies:
Superior Granule Quality: Produces extremely hard and dense granules that resist dusting and attrition during handling, bagging, and shipping, resulting in a premium, market-ready product.
Exceptional Efficiency & Lower OPEX: The process requires no drying ovens or liquid binders, slashing thermal energy costs and simplifying the production line. It operates continuously with high throughput and low electrical consumption.
Maximized Nutrient Integrity: As a completely dry process, it eliminates the risk of nutrient degradation or dissolution that can occur in wet granulation and subsequent high-temperature drying, crucial for product quality.
Operational Simplicity & Flexibility: With fewer components than a wet line (no atomizers, dryers, or complex liquid systems), it is easier to operate and maintain. Granule size can be easily adjusted by changing the crusher or screen settings.
Environmentally Friendly Production: The closed-loop system with 100% recycle of fines creates no effluent or wastewater, supporting sustainable manufacturing goals.
4. Integration into a Complete LANE Production Line
A LANE SOP fertilizer production line is engineered for seamless integration. The double roller granulator is the pivotal component in a streamlined sequence:

Pre-Conditioning: Raw SOP powder is prepared to optimal moisture content (<2%) and fed into the system.
Granulation: The powder is compacted and formed into granules via the roller press as described.
Sizing & Finishing: Granules are precisely screened with rotary screener to the target size (typically 2-4mm). An optional coating drum can apply anti-caking agents to further enhance flow and storage properties.
Product Handling: The finished SOP granules are conveyed directly to storage silos or automated packaging system.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: Is the double roller granulator suitable for other fertilizer types?
A: Yes. This technology is highly effective for a wide range of dry, powdery materials, including MAP, DAP, potassium chloride (MOP), and various NPK blends, making it a versatile investment.
Q2: What about moisture content in the raw material?
A: Low moisture is critical for success. Ideal feed material should be dry (1-2% moisture). Excess moisture can cause roll sticking and soft granules. LANE can advise on pre-drying solutions if needed.
Q3: How does granule hardness from a roller press compare to other methods?
A: Granules from a double roller granulator are typically harder and more abrasion-resistant than those from rotary drum or disc granulators, as they are formed by pure compression rather than layering or agglomeration.
